Turkey Lettuce Wraps with Sauce

These turkey lettuce wraps are a quick and healthy meal, perfect for a light lunch or dinner. They feature savory ground turkey, crisp vegetables, and a flavorful sauce, all wrapped in fresh lettuce leaves.

Ingredients

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 pound ground turkey
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 red bell pepper, diced
  • 1/2 cup shredded carrots
  • 1/4 cup soy sauce (or tamari for gluten-free)
  • 2 tablespoons rice v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 1 teaspoon grated fresh ginger
  • 1/2 teaspoon red pepper flakes (optional)
  • 1 head butter lettuce or romaine lettuce, leaves separated
  • 1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ro, for garnish
  • 2 tablespoons chopped peanuts, for garnish (optional)

Instructions

  1. Heat olive oil in a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at. Add ground turkey and cook, breaking it up with a spoon, until browned and cooked through, about 5-7 minutes. Drain any excess fat.
  2. Add onion, garlic, red bell pepper, and shredded carrots to the skillet. Cook, stirring occasionally, until vegetables are tender-crisp, about 5 minutes.
  3. In a small bowl, whisk together soy sauce, rice vinegar, honey, ginger, and red pepper flakes (if using). Pour the sauce over the turkey and vegetable mixture. Stir well to coat and cook for 2-3 minutes, allowing the sauce to thicken slightly.
  4. Remove from heat.
  5. To serve, spoon the turkey mixture into individual lettuce leaves. Garnish with fresh cilantro and chopped peanuts, if desired.

Notes

  • You can substitute ground chicken or lean ground beef for turkey.
  • For extra spice, add more red pepper flakes.
  • Serve with a side of brown rice or quinoa for a heartier meal.
  • Prepare the turkey mixture ahead of time and store in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Assemble wraps just before serving.
